DARKSIDERS™ COMING TO THE PC
Apocalyptic adventure title optimized for a summer release on PC

AGOURA HILLS, Calif. March 29, 2010 — THQ Inc. (NASDAQ: THQI) today announced that its critically acclaimed action-adventure title DarksidersTM will be coming to the PC in June.

Released earlier this year for Xbox 360® and Playstation®3, Darksiders will be available for PC gamers to enjoy in all of its apocalyptic glory this summer. Developed by THQ's in-house studio Vigil Games™, this version of the game is being meticulously crafted to deliver the same great art ****and dynamic game play to a whole new audience.

Travis Plane, Vice President of Global Brand Management commented, "We are delighted to be able to bring Darksiders to the PC. THQ is focused on bringing great product to the PC gaming audience so it was vital that we allowed Vigil the time to optimize the title for the PC platform. We hope PC gamers experience the same thrill and get the same level of satisfaction assuming the mantle of WAR as the console audience did."

David Adams, General Manager of Vigil Games commented, "We are really excited to have the opportunity to bring Darksiders to the global PC audience. We feel that the growth of digital distribution and PC online communities creates a great environment for our game. We are working really hard to make sure that key features such as user-defined resolutions, interface and both keyboard and game pad control sets are all up to the standards for today's discerning PC consumer."
